MS SQL数据库事务日志管理优化策略与实践
MS SQL数据库事务日志管理的优化策略,关键在于确保日志的有效管理、降低增长速度以及优化写入性能,从而保障数据库的稳定性与高效运行。以下是几种关键策略: 2025AI图片生成,仅供参考 确保事务日志文件大小适当。事务日志文件应设置为足够大的空间,以容纳日常的事务数据活动。管理员需定期监控日志文件的增长和使用情况,并根据实际情况及时调整日志文件的大小。这有助于避免因日志文件过小而导致的频繁增长和数据库性能下降的问题。定期备份事务日志。事务日志的定期备份是释放日志空间、减少日志文件大小的有效手段。通过设定定期的事务日志备份计划,不仅可以确保日志的安全存储,还能防止日志文件无限制增长,影响数据库性能。备份完成后,可以考虑截断或收缩事务日志文件以回收利用空间。 使用简单恢复模式。对于不需要严格的事务日志恢复操作的数据库,可以考虑将数据库的恢复模式设置为简单模式。简单恢复模式能显著减少事务日志的增长速度,因为它不要求保留未备份的事务日志用于后续的恢复操作。但需注意,简单恢复模式下,数据库无法执行时间点恢复。 优化事务日志写入操作。通过优化数据库设计和应用程序逻辑,减少不必要的事务或批量处理事务,可以减少事务日志的写入频率和总体数据量。合理设计索引、避免大批量的更新操作、优化SQL语句等手段也有助于提高事务日志的写入效率。 监控与分析事务日志的使用情况。使用SQL Server提供的事务日志分析工具,对日志中的事务操作、日志增长原因进行分析,有助于识别潜在的性能瓶颈和问题并进行针对性的优化调整。持续监控事务日志文件的大小和增长速度,也是保障数据库性能的重要步骤。 通过上述策略的实施,可以有效管理和优化MS SQL数据库的事务日志系统,确保数据库的高效运行和稳定性。定期的维护和监控是保持日志系统健康、避免未来性能问题的关键。 (编辑:成都站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
- sql-server – 如何找出是谁/什么是锤击SQL Server TempDB
- sql – 当结果集很大时,RODBC会丢失datetime的时间值
- sql-server – SQL Server注入 – 26个字符中有多少损坏?
- 微软阻止荷兰Lindows销售 称只针对软件名字
- sql-server-2000 – 查询以获取SQL Server 2000中的所有外键
- sql-server-2005 – 从SQL Server 2008降级到2005
- 【小编带你学】深入ADO.NET:C#编程中的数据访问高级技巧(
- Windows无法查询DllName注册表项它将不会被加载
- 21世纪经济报道:微软关闭MSN传言的背后
- MsSql中的XML数据存储与查询操作技巧